Distinguished President, at present, I am the citizen of both the USA and Canada. Now I work in the capacity of the chairman of the Canadian "Alberta Energy". As You know, our company has a 5 percent share in "Alov" oil deposit. However we intend to make new investments in Azerbaijan in the sum exceeding this.

I want to briefly inform You about the "Alberta Energy" Company. Our company is the biggest independent Canadian company. Annual turnover of our company is 6 billion dollars. We produce 30 thousand tons of oil daily.

Our company is producing the biggest quantity of natural gas in Canada. We also export much gas to the USA.

"Alberta Energy" is the largest company operating pipelines in Canada. Therefore I have brought with me the president and vice-president of the "Alberta Energy" Company responsible for production. Heydar Aliyev: Thank You. My esteemed friend, I say again that I am pleased to see You in Azerbaijan. It is true that we laid the basis of the big oil contract in 1994. The USA "AMOCO" headed by You then showed really great interest in Azerbaijan, it was one of the first companies to arrive in Azerbaijan, 19 contracts have been signed so far, 32 oil companies work in Azerbaijan representing the interests of 14 countries. One of them is the Canadian "Alberta Energy".
